All Saints, Fordham Church of England Primary School children share their concerns and ideas about rough sleeping with Bishop Guli

19 December 2024

Bishop Guli at All Saints, Fordham Primary

Earlier this year, Oak Class at All Saints Fordham Primary School wrote a letter to Bishop Guli, sharing their concerns about people sleeping rough in terrible weather. The reception class had been learning about poverty and compassion and decided to write to Bishop Guli about what the Church might do to help.

After reading the letter Bishop Guli wrote back to the children and their teacher Mrs Styant to thank them for their ideas and share some of the things people in churches are doing across Chelmsford Diocese to help people in their local communities. She also asked the children if she could visit them at school so she could hear some more about their ideas. Bishop Guli recently visited the children and Mrs Styant and is pictured with them.
